What is Frozen Puff Pastry?
The French call this rich, delicate, multilayered pastry, Pate Feuilletee. It’s made by placing pats of butter between layers of pastry dough, then rolling it out, folding it in thirds and letting it rest. This process, which is repeated 6 to 8 times, produces a pastry consisting of hundreds of layers of dough and butter.
When baked, the moisture in the butter creates steam, causing the dough to puff and separate into hundreds of flaky layers. Puff pastry is used to make a variety of crisp creations including croissants, napoleons, palmier, and allumettes. Puff Pastry is also used as a wrapping for various foods such as meats, cheese, fruit and salmon.

Easy Banana Puffs
Ingredients
- 1 21 oz can banana cream pie filling or any pie filling of your choice
- 1 17.3 oz package frozen puff pastry, 2 sheets thawed
- 2 tablespoons milk
- 1/4 cup powdered sugar
Instructions
- On a lightly floured surface, roll 1 of the pastry sheets into a 12-inch square. Cut into 6 squares. Top each square with about 2 teaspoons pie filling. Brush pastry edges with milk. Fold in half diagonally, seal edges by pressing with the tines of a fork. Place on an ungreased baking sheet. Repeat with remaining pastry sheet and filling.
- Bake in a 400° oven 12 to 15 minutes or until golden brown. Cool on wire rack.
- Dust lightly with powdered sugar.
